We are recruiting for a Highly Specialised Physiologist - CRM who shares our vision to be trusted to provide consistently outstanding care and exemplary service to our patients.

An exciting opportunity for an accredited devices physiologist to join a small and dynamic CRM team at the Lister hospital. We provide support across the trust and into the community. The team are encouraged to bring ideas and service developments/improvements to the team in line with trust values.

We support a busy complex and brady service with an established face to face pacing clinic and remote follow up. As a team we feel strongly that face to face element is an important part, or our role and skill set and beneficial for the patients.

In 2023, we supported over 700 device procedures, and the service is showing year on year growth.

We are very excited to have appointed two new device and EP consultants. The introduction of conduction pacing and a community ICD deactivation service in the last 6mths. The potential for this service is endless.

We have an established apprenticeship and equivalence program which the successful candidate would be expected to support as the team would support you in fulfilling your full potential.

We would consider the right band 6 applicant to support through their accreditation process.

Main duties of the job

As a highly specialised Cardiac Physiologist you will be required to work as an highly specialist practitioner within the Cardiology Department, with a specialisation in device management. The successful candidate will work closely with the Lead Cardiac Physiologist

All band 7 staff are expected to assist in the management of the Cardiac Physiology Service across trust sites, and to demonstrate a high level of competency in all sections of the Technical Cardiology Department.

The role is vital in the provision of training, continuing professional development and overall performance of all staff in the Pacing/ICD section of the Cardiology Department. You will be expected to play a major role in the continuing professional development and overall performance of all staff in the technical cardiology service.

You would be expected to hold the relevant accreditation - IBHRE/BHRS
